Steelers vs. Titans, Week 6: A pair of 2-win teams

Don't look now, but following Thursday night's surprising 26-23 upset in Nashville, Tenn., the Tennessee Titans and Pittsburgh Steelers are both two-win teams six weeks into the 2012 NFL season.

Even Jimmy Morris over at SB Nation Titans blog Music City Miracles didn't think his team had a shot. Late Thursday night, Morris wrote about what a nice surprise it was:

"Sometimes it is good to be wrong, and this is one of those times. I didn't think the Titans had any shot at winning this game, but they proved me wrong tonight. There were still some of the issues we have seen in other games, but they had a fight in them tonight that we have not seen this season. Hopefully they can keep that going for the rest of the year."

Morris' main theme for the night? Redemption. Matt Hasselbeck, Kenny Britt and Jason McCourty all overcame earlier mistakes help the Titans (2-3) hand the Steelers (2-3) their third straight road defeat:

"It was a night of guys coming back after making big mistakes. Jason McCourty got torched early in the game on the long touchdown pass to Mike Wallace, but he came back and had a huge interception before the half to keep the Steelers from getting any points heading into the intermission.

Matt Hasselbeck threw an ugly pick in the fourth quarter that set up a field goal that put the Steelers up 23-16. He came back to lead an 11 play 80 yard touchdown that drive that was capped off with a pass to Kenny Britt."

KG Drummers offers up his thoughts, as well, including an early prediction that the Titans, with momentum on their sides, will beat the Buffalo Bills next week.
